For over 25 years, I have operated behind the scenes across the UK finance, property, and technology sectors — from Morgan Stanley and EY to independent consulting and property portfolio management.
My earliest business education came as a teenager, working in my father's souvenir business in central London — managing stock, coordinating staff, and learning that business is about people first.
Today, I channel that experience into MyHaVn — a technology platform focused on protecting women and individuals affected by domestic violence. Built on evidence-based research and strict confidentiality, because privacy is not a feature. It is the foundation.

Morgan Stanley Dean Witter (B2B client acquisition) and Ernst & Young (data security protocols). Learning how large UK institutions operate, scale, and protect their interests.
CTI Data Solutions — carrier-grade software, e-billing, advanced analytics, cloud-based interaction recording, and call logging infrastructure.
Lead consultant for The Harley Group. Property portfolio management across contracts, lettings, and renovations. Side projects and startups as learning exercises.
Retraining in AI and cybersecurity. Developing MyHaVn — evidence-based safety technology for domestic violence prevention. Seeking investment and strategic partnerships.
